Decent Attack and Speed, horrid defenses, and a pretty shallow movepool. The saving grace for this Bass is definitely its choices of ability; three very solid choices. Reckless increases the damage done by double edge. Rock Head gets rid of the recoil. Adaptability increases STAB from x1.5 to x2.0. Not bad at all.

But which ability is the right one?
Rock Head adds bulkiness, Reckless causes mass damage(Both from Double Edge, Basculin's only reliable recoil move). Adaptability increases the STAB bonuses of all of Basculin's water attacks. Rock head makes our dear bass completely outclassed by Relicanth, who, with the same ability, can throw Head Smashes out with mass power. Reckless really limits this fish's staying power, as although it does extra damage, recoil is also increased. Adaptability is extremely reliable, increasing Aqua Tail/Jet's power.

I've used Basculin before, and it really is not that bad. The main problem it runs into is with it's unfortunate speed. 98 is nice, but there are so many 100s out there that it really hurts its viability. Adaptability, imo, is the only reason to use Basulin. Thanks to Adaptability, it's water moves hit like they are coming off a base stat of around 140, which is pretty impressive. If you can get some rain going then he really has some awesome power, which is backed nicely by Aqua Jet to make up for the lackluster speed. Unfortunately, that's about all that is special about it. As far as I am concerned, If you are not utilizing Adaptability with Basculin, you probably should be using another Pokemon.
